Determination of strontium-90
Samples of plankton and a sample of shrimp were analyzed for gr99
by the ion-exchange method of Kawabata and Held.
The ashed sample
was first treated with 80 per cent HNO3 to remove strontium from
the
bulk of the sample and from most of the other radioisotopes present.
The solution containing the strontium nitrate precipitate was filtered
through a glass filter and was then dissolved in hot 0.2N HCl.
After
cooling, it was passed through a cationic resin column and possible
contaminants were eluted from the column with 0.5 per cent oxalic
acid and 5 per cent ammonium citrate at pH 3.5.
The column was then
stored for 14 days to allow the ¥29 daughter to build up.
The Y99 was
reeluted from the column with ammonium citrate at pH 3.5 and
the
amount of Sr9° present was calculated from the amount of ¥99 recovered.
The identity of ¥99 was confirmed by determining the decay rate of the
sample eluted.
